Items included in a sale of used equipment by the city of Corner Brook will be available to view this Wednesday, June 18th. Those interested can meet with representatives at the city’s depot on Charles Street between 1-3 p.m. They will be accepting bids and all items as “As is, where is.” Items include a loader, a couple of Ford trucks, a couple of sanders, a litter collector and a land and garden tractor. For more information email dmarshall@cornerbrook.com. Tenders will close on June 25th.
